Overview
- Based on May Cobb’s bestselling novel, the series tracks Sophie O’Neil’s spiral into a secretive East Texas clique where late-night gunplay and a teenage girl’s murder upend her life.
- Showrunner Rebecca Cutter adapted the eight-part thriller for Netflix after Lionsgate reclaimed the series from its original Starz development.
- Early reviews highlight its blend of erotic, soap-style twists with an unflinching look at red-state versus blue-state cultural clashes.
- Netflix released all episodes simultaneously on July 21 in the U.S., positioning the show as a high-octane binge-watch event.
- No release window has been announced for the U.K. or other international territories, leaving global availability uncertain.
